#asktheexperts namaskar sir. is it essential to give vitamin d drops to 2 months baby? Or else is it sufficient if a lactating mother take vitamin d supplement

A. A child is meant to be given vitamin D and multivitamin supplement for initial six months to one year of birth as per your doctor recommendation what mother is taking is separate and what child is taking is totally separate
